The ebook requirement makes it hard. Some of the James Herriot are on Amazon in audio, but no ebook I can see.

As a kid I loved "The Silver Brumby" books by Elyne Mitchell, but so far the only audio of the first book I can see is on cassette. A couple of others look like they may be available on CD. I just did a search for another favourite from when I was a kid, books by Joseph E. Chipperfield ("Rex of Larkbarrow" and similar), but none of those seem to be available in ebooks or audio either. I remember enjoying "Hunter's Moon" by Garry Kilworth, but again no ebook.

Things are looking pretty desperate until you remember "The Wind in the Willows" by Kenneth Grahame - just one of the best books ever written AND, believe it or not, available in audio and ebook. ... and this leads to William Horwood's follow-ons, they aren't up to the original but they're not too bad and they seem to be available in audio. Too bad Horwood's other animal books (Callanish, the Duncton Wood series etc) don't seem to be available.

"Watership Down" by Richard Adams is available in Kindle and audio, and if you ever see "Shardik" or "The Plague Dogs" then I'd recommend them too.

That's about as good as I can do off the top of my head.
